The National Association of Broadcasters (NAB) will produce four sessions at the SET Expo in São Paulo, Brazil, August 24-25. The sessions will address topics ranging from sports production, 4K video, media management in the cloud, and producing content for multiple devices. NAB's participation in SET is part of the NAB Show Collaborative, an initiative to support the advancement of the global broadcast, media and entertainment communities.

WASHINGTON, DC -- The Consent Decrees governing the licensing of musical works performance rights by ASCAP and BMI provide important protections for licensees from potential anti-competitive behavior by the performance rights organizations (PROs) and their protections should be maintained in full, NAB said in comments filed today with the Department of Justice's Antitrust Division.

WASHINGTON, DC -- The rationale underlying several decades-old media ownership rules that broadcast television stations only compete against themselves in local markets is simply not true, the National Association of Broadcasters said in comments filed today with the FCC. The Commission should adjust its rules to better reflect today and tomorrow's marketplace that features competition from rival industries as it weighs relaxing ownership restrictions, NAB said.

The 2014 Radio Show will feature FCC Commissioner Ajit Pai, who will engage in a conversation with NAB President and CEO Gordon Smith at the Radio Luncheon, held Friday, September 12. The 2014 Radio Show, jointly produced by the Radio Advertising Bureau (RAB) and National Association of Broadcasters (NAB), will be held September 10-12 in Indianapolis.

Following the success of the New Media Lounge at the 2014 NAB Show, New Media Expo (NMX) and NAB have agreed to expand their collaboration. NMX will co-locate its entire event and introduce tens of thousands of new media content creators and disruptive businesses to the NAB Show, April 13 - 16, 2015.

The 2014 Radio Show, produced by the Radio Advertising Bureau (RAB) and National Association of Broadcasters (NAB), will include a Super Session interview between Dan Harris, co-anchor of ABC's "Nightline" and "Good Morning America" weekend edition, and Alan Mulally, former president and chief executive officer of Ford Motor Company and current Google board member. The Super Session will occur Thursday, September 11 at 3:00 p.m.

About WVBA

The West Virginia Broadcasters Association has been representing and serving West Virginia commercial radio and television stations since 1946. We are a member-driven trade association that provides unequaled service and value to stations throughout the state.
